Ask some mathematicians and they'd say pi is sacred. Ask some foodies and they'd agree. Ask me on March 14th and I'll tell you I am having a serious pi craving! At Sacred Pi the doors open and happy hour starts at 3:14pm each day. The dough is mixed by hand daily in-house and they pull their own mozzarella cheese, too. Add-in a dog friendly patio, eclectic drink & signature cocktail menu, and indie music for a background soundtrack to create a hipster dining experience that, in my opinion, rivals local favorites like Cornish Pasty Co. and Postino. Sacred Pi has turned me into a beer-liever -- OMG the Beerimsu! It is not always available but make sure to get a slice (or two) if it is. Each visit we've been helped by Erick, who was very polite but probably could use some more help when the restaurant is busy. Pacing of our meals suffered slightly due to the one person wait-staff. A solid 3.14159265359...stars for Sacred Pi, rounded up to 4 for good measure and because combining math puns and pizza is cool! Happy Pi Day, Sacred Pi!
